Global Plastic Composite Market Size

  • The global Plastic Composite Market size was valued at USD 6.36 billion in 2024 and is expected to reach USD 17.54 billion by 2032, at a CAGR of 13.50% during the forecast period.
  • The market growth is largely driven by increasing applications of plastic composites in automotive, construction, and aerospace industries, coupled with innovations in lightweight and high-strength materials.
  • Moreover, rising demand for sustainable, cost-effective, and durable materials across various sectors is fueling the adoption of plastic composites, thereby significantly accelerating the market expansion

Global Plastic Composite Market Analysis

  • Plastic composites, combining polymers with reinforcements such as glass or carbon fibers, are increasingly vital materials in automotive, construction, and aerospace applications due to their high strength-to-weight ratio, durability, and versatility.
  • The escalating demand for plastic composites is primarily fueled by the need for lightweight, cost-effective, and sustainable materials, alongside technological advancements in polymer formulations and composite manufacturing techniques.
  • North America dominated the Global Plastic Composite Market with the largest revenue share of 35% in 2024, characterized by strong industrial infrastructure, early adoption of advanced materials, and a robust presence of key industry players, with the U.S. experiencing substantial growth in automotive and aerospace applications driven by innovations in high-performance composites.
  • Asia-Pacific is expected to be the fastest-growing region in the Global Plastic Composite Market during the forecast period due to rapid industrialization, expanding automotive and construction sectors, and rising disposable incomes.
  • The Polyvinylchloride segment dominated the market with a revenue share of 41.5% in 2024, driven by its superior durability, fire and chemical resistance, and wide adoption in construction, electrical insulation, and piping applications

Global Plastic Composite Market Trends

Advancements in High-Performance and Sustainable Composites

  • A significant and accelerating trend in the global Plastic Composite Market is the development of high-performance and sustainable composite materials, combining polymers with reinforcements such as glass, carbon, or natural fibers. These innovations are enhancing material properties, including strength, durability, and environmental sustainability, for use across automotive, construction, and aerospace sectors.
    • For instance, carbon fiber-reinforced thermoplastics are being adopted in automotive lightweighting applications, improving fuel efficiency while maintaining structural integrity. Similarly, bio-based composites are increasingly utilized in construction panels, offering eco-friendly alternatives without compromising performance.
  • Advanced composites enable applications such as impact-resistant automotive components, corrosion-resistant piping, and heat-resistant aerospace parts. Some manufacturers, like Toray and BASF, are developing next-generation composites with improved thermal stability, enhanced mechanical properties, and lower environmental impact.
  • The seamless integration of these advanced composites into manufacturing processes, including 3D printing and automated fabrication systems, facilitates efficiency and scalability. Companies can now produce high-performance components with consistent quality while reducing material waste.
  • This trend toward stronger, lighter, and more sustainable composites is fundamentally reshaping material selection in key industries. Consequently, companies such as Covestro, Hexcel, and Solvay are focusing on high-performance solutions that meet stringent environmental and regulatory standards while enhancing product durability and functionality.
  • The demand for innovative, versatile, and eco-friendly plastic composites is growing rapidly across automotive, construction, and aerospace applications, as industries increasingly prioritize performance, sustainability, and cost-efficiency.

Global Plastic Composite Market Dynamics

Driver

Growing Demand Driven by Lightweighting, Sustainability, and Industrial Applications

  • The increasing emphasis on energy efficiency, sustainability, and high-performance materials across automotive, aerospace, and construction sectors is a significant driver for the heightened demand for plastic composites.
    • For instance, in 2024, BASF announced the development of a new lightweight carbon fiber-reinforced composite for automotive applications, targeting fuel efficiency and reduced emissions. Such innovations by key companies are expected to drive the plastic composite market growth during the forecast period.
  • As industries prioritize reducing carbon footprints and improving material efficiency, plastic composites offer advantages such as high strength-to-weight ratios, corrosion resistance, and durability, providing a compelling alternative to traditional metals and construction materials.
  • Furthermore, the growing adoption of automated manufacturing, 3D printing, and sustainable production processes is making plastic composites an integral component of modern industrial applications, offering versatility and cost efficiency.
  • The ability to design complex, lightweight components with improved mechanical performance and environmental benefits is key to propelling the adoption of plastic composites across automotive, aerospace, and construction sectors. Increasing awareness of eco-friendly materials and stricter regulatory standards further support market expansion.

Restraint/Challenge

High Production Costs and Recycling Limitations

  • The relatively high production costs of advanced composites, including carbon fiber and hybrid polymer composites, pose a challenge to wider adoption, particularly in cost-sensitive applications.
    • For instance, the cost of producing carbon fiber-reinforced plastics remains higher than traditional metals, limiting their use in price-conscious markets despite their performance advantages.
  • Addressing these challenges through improved manufacturing efficiency, economies of scale, and research into lower-cost composite materials is crucial for expanding market penetration. Companies such as Toray, Solvay, and Covestro are investing in production optimization and novel resin systems to reduce costs.
  • Additionally, recycling and end-of-life management of composite materials remain complex, as separating fibers from polymers is challenging, which can hinder sustainability efforts and raise regulatory concerns.
  • Overcoming these challenges through technological advancements in recycling, cost reduction strategies, and greater adoption of bio-based composites will be vital for sustained market growth.

Global Plastic Composite Market Scope

Plastic composite market is segmented on the basis of product and application.

  • By Product

On the basis of product, the Global Plastic Composite Market is segmented into Polyethylene (PE), Polypropylene (PP), Polyvinyl Chloride (PVC), and Others. The PVC segment dominated the market with a revenue share of 41.5% in 2024, driven by its superior durability, fire and chemical resistance, and wide adoption in construction, electrical insulation, and piping applications. PVC composites are preferred due to their low maintenance, cost-effectiveness, and adaptability across residential, commercial, and industrial projects.

The Polypropylene segment is expected to witness the fastest CAGR of 19.2% from 2025 to 2032, fueled by growing demand in lightweight applications, automotive components, packaging solutions, and industrial products. Polyethylene continues to sustain steady demand for flexible packaging, containers, and household goods, while specialty composites included in “Others” are increasingly applied in aerospace, renewable energy, and marine industries. The combination of durability, versatility, and innovation across these materials positions the product segment as a key driver of overall market growth.

  • By Application

On the basis of application, the Global Plastic Composite Market is segmented into Building and Construction, Automotive Components, Industrial and Consumer Goods, and Others. The Building and Construction segment dominated the market in 2024 with a revenue share of 44.3%, attributed to the increasing use of lightweight, durable, and corrosion-resistant materials in residential, commercial, and infrastructure projects. Plastic composites are extensively utilized in roofing, flooring, piping, cladding, and window profiles due to their strength, low maintenance, and cost efficiency.

The Automotive Components segment is anticipated to witness the fastest CAGR of 18.7% from 2025 to 2032, supported by the automotive industry’s shift toward lightweight materials, fuel efficiency, and high-performance composites for interior and exterior parts. Industrial and consumer goods applications, including appliances, furniture, and packaging, provide steady growth, while “Others” covers niche applications such as aerospace, marine, and renewable energy, reflecting the expanding versatility of plastic composites.

Global Plastic Composite Market Regional Analysis

  • North America dominated the Global Plastic Composite Market with the largest revenue share of 35% in 2024, driven by high demand for lightweight, durable, and cost-effective plastic composite materials across construction, automotive, and industrial sectors.
  • Consumers and businesses in the region prioritize materials that offer superior strength-to-weight ratios, corrosion resistance, and design flexibility, which make plastic composites an attractive alternative to traditional metals and woods.
  • This widespread adoption is further supported by advanced manufacturing capabilities, high awareness of sustainable and energy-efficient materials, and strong investments in infrastructure and automotive innovation. The combination of regulatory support for green building practices, growing urbanization, and demand for lightweight automotive components positions North America as a leading market for plastic composites in both industrial and consumer applications.

U.S. Plastic Composite Market Insight

The U.S. plastic composite market captured the largest revenue share of 35% in 2024 within North America, driven by growing demand for lightweight, durable, and cost-effective materials in automotive, construction, and consumer goods sectors. Manufacturers are increasingly prioritizing plastic composites for their high strength-to-weight ratio, corrosion resistance, and design versatility. The adoption is further supported by advanced manufacturing technologies, government initiatives promoting sustainable materials, and strong investments in infrastructure and green building projects. The U.S. market is also propelled by rising consumer awareness of energy-efficient and eco-friendly materials, particularly in residential construction and automotive components.

Europe Plastic Composite Market Insight

The Europe plastic composite market is projected to expand at a significant CAGR during the forecast period, primarily driven by stringent environmental regulations, growing demand for lightweight and sustainable materials, and increased urbanization. European manufacturers and construction companies are adopting composites to enhance energy efficiency, reduce emissions, and optimize design flexibility. Key sectors such as automotive, industrial machinery, and infrastructure are experiencing considerable growth, fueled by the preference for corrosion-resistant and long-lasting materials. Adoption is further encouraged in both new construction and renovation projects, supported by regional policies promoting green materials.

Germany Plastic Composite Market Insight

The Germany plastic composite market is expected to grow at a considerable CAGR, driven by the country’s strong industrial base, emphasis on technological innovation, and sustainability initiatives. High demand from the automotive, construction, and industrial machinery sectors supports market expansion. Germany’s focus on research and development, combined with strict environmental regulations, promotes the use of eco-friendly composite materials. Additionally, the integration of plastic composites in manufacturing and construction enables lightweight, durable, and cost-efficient solutions, which aligns with local consumer and business expectations for high-performance and sustainable materials.

Asia-Pacific Plastic Composite Market Insight

The Asia-Pacific plastic composite market is poised to grow at the fastest CAGR of 22% during 2025–2032, driven by rapid industrialization, urbanization, and rising disposable incomes in countries such as China, Japan, and India. Increasing demand for lightweight automotive components, modern construction materials, and consumer goods accelerates market adoption. The region’s role as a major manufacturing hub for plastic composites ensures affordability and wider accessibility. Government initiatives supporting digitalization, sustainable infrastructure, and eco-friendly materials further enhance market growth, particularly in construction, automotive, and industrial applications.

Japan Plastic Composite Market Insight

The Japan plastic composite market is witnessing steady growth due to the country’s focus on technological innovation, high manufacturing standards, and demand for energy-efficient materials. Rising urbanization and the need for lightweight, durable, and sustainable components in automotive, construction, and consumer products drive adoption. Japan’s aging population also supports demand for safer, lightweight building and industrial materials. Integration of plastic composites in advanced manufacturing, combined with government emphasis on eco-friendly materials, is enhancing market penetration in both industrial and residential sectors.

China Plastic Composite Market Insight

The China plastic composite market accounted for the largest market revenue share in Asia-Pacific in 2024, supported by rapid urbanization, an expanding industrial sector, and strong domestic manufacturing capabilities. The rising middle class and increased demand for durable, lightweight materials in construction, automotive, and consumer goods sectors are major growth drivers. Additionally, government policies promoting green building materials and energy efficiency, along with the presence of local manufacturers offering cost-effective solutions, are fueling adoption across residential, commercial, and industrial applications.
